Multiple people missing after rainstorms in East China

Xinhua | Updated: 2026-09-04 17:11

FUZHOU -- Multiple residents in East China's Fujian province are still unaccounted for after days of heavy rainfall, local authorities said on Friday.

Torrential rains brought by Typhoon Saudel caused secondary disasters in the Huating town, Chengxiang district of Putian city. According to an official with the township government, a number of residents remain unaccounted for, but the exact number is not yet clear. More than 100 houses collapsed in the town.

A dike was overtopped and breached at about 3 pm Thursday, flooding nearby villages and trapping residents.

A total of 1,261 people in the Chengxiang district have been evacuated, with 30 disaster shelters activated.

As of Friday noon, rain was continuing in Putian, with showers and thundershowers forecast for the afternoons over the next four days.
